Heim >Web-Frontend >js-Tutorial >So finden Sie Elemente in js
Die Methoden zum Suchen von Elementen in JavaScript sind: getElementById(id): Verwenden Sie die Element-ID, um Elemente zu finden. getElementsByClassName(className): Elemente mithilfe von Klassennamen suchen. getElementsByTagName(tagName): Elemente mithilfe von Tag-Namen suchen. querySelectorAll(selector): Elemente mithilfe von CSS-Selektoren finden. querySelector(selector): Verwenden Sie einen CSS-Selektor, um das erste passende Element zu finden.
Methoden zum Suchen von Elementen in JavaScript
In JavaScript gibt es die folgenden gängigen Methoden zum Suchen von Elementen:
1. getElementById(id):
Verwenden Sie das eindeutige ID-Attribut des Elements, um Element finden. Es gibt das erste Element mit der angegebenen ID zurück.
Beispiel:
<code class="javascript">const element = document.getElementById('myElement');</code>
2. getElementsByClassName(className):
Suchen Sie ein Element mithilfe seines Klassennamenattributs. Es gibt eine Sammlung aller Elemente mit dem angegebenen Klassennamen zurück.
Beispiel:
<code class="javascript">const elements = document.getElementsByClassName('myClass');</code>
3. getElementsByTagName(tagName):
Elemente mithilfe von HTML-Tag-Namen suchen. Es gibt eine Sammlung aller Elemente mit dem angegebenen Tag zurück.
Beispiel:
<code class="javascript">const elements = document.getElementsByTagName('p');</code>
4. querySelectorAll(selector):
Eine allgemeine Suchmethode, die CSS-Selektoren verwendet, um Elemente aus dem Dokument zu finden. Es gibt eine Sammlung aller Elemente zurück, die mit dem Selektor übereinstimmen.
Beispiel:
<code class="javascript">const elements = document.querySelectorAll('.myClass p'); // 选择带有 myClass 类名的段落</code>
5. querySelector(selector):
Ähnlich wie querySelectorAll, aber es gibt nur das erste Element zurück, das mit dem Selector übereinstimmt.
Beispiel:
<code class="javascript">const element = document.querySelector('.myClass');</code>
Andere Methoden:
Das obige ist der detaillierte Inhalt vonSo finden Sie Elemente in js.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!